Summary:
"Greenwich Village, 1958. Earl, a black, gay actor, and Bette, a white secretary, have been neighbors for thirty years, forming a deep bond as refugees from small-minded hometowns. But when Hortense, a wealthy young actress with links to Bette's painful past, shows up, Earl and Bette's hard won assumptions are shaken to the core. The Cosmopolitans is a beautifully written, page turning novel about friendship, love and revenge set in the disappeared world of 1950's New York."--P. [4] of cover.
